Any interested person or any committee member may file with the committee a prepared statement concerning a specific instrument or matter under consideration by the committee or concerning any matter within the committee's scope of authority, and the committee records shall reflect receipt of such statement and the date and time thereof.
NOTE: Statements may be filed with the House Committee on House and Governmental Affairs via email at h&ga@legis.la.gov. Statements submitted, and the information contained therein, are public records and subject to disclosure pursuant to public records laws.
Audio/visual presentations, such as PowerPoint, shall be filed with the House Committee on House and Governmental Affairs via email at h&ga@legis.la.gov at least 24 hours prior to the scheduled start of the committee meeting. No flash or thumb drives will be accepted.
